
BMW 1 Series118i [136] M Sport 5dr Step Auto [LCP]
£24,590
£24,590
£24,590
£562 off£22,990
£1,127 off£27,490
£607 off£24,944
£20,748
£18,990
£27,798
£25,550
£31,997
£22,095
£31,795
£29,450
£38,150
£20,650
£24,995
£25,950
£22,395
19-36 of 68 vehicles